What you need to know about the Edinburgh Tech Scene

From traditional pubs and centuries-old universities to sleek shopping malls and glass-paneled office buildings, Edinburgh's architecture reflects its unique blend of history and modernity. But the fusion of past and future isn't just visible in its buildings; it's also shaping the city's economy. Named the United Kingdom's leading technology ecosystem outside of London, Edinburgh plays host to major global companies like Apple and Adobe, as well as a growing number of innovative startups in fields like cybersecurity, finance and healthcare.
